Understanding Remote Patient Monitoring Software
Remote patient monitoring software enables healthcare providers to collect, analyze, and act on patient health data from a distance. Devices like blood pressure monitors, glucometers, and pulse oximeters send real-time data directly to the provider’s dashboard. This allows for timely interventions, improved patient outcomes, and more efficient care management. Key Features to Consider
User-Friendly Interface
A remote patient monitoring software should offer an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face for both healthcare providers and patients. A complicated system can hinder adoption and reduce patient compliance. Key points to consider include:
Simple setup process for both providers and patients
Clear dashboards for tracking vital signs and trends
Easy-to-understand data visualization
Multilingual support for diverse patient populations
Seamless Device Integration
The software should support integration with a wide range of medical devices. This ensures that various patient needs can be addressed without switching platforms. Look for:
Compatibility with popular health devices (glucometers, blood pressure monitors, ECGs, etc.)
Automatic data synchronization from devices to the software
Support for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, and cellular connectivity
Real-Time Data Transmission and Alerts
Timely data transmission is critical for effective remote care. A robust remote patient monitoring software provides:
Real-time data collection and uploads
Customizable alerts for abnormal readings
Automated notifications for both providers and patients
Comprehensive Data Analytics
To improve clinical decision-making, the software should offer advanced data analytics. This helps healthcare providers identify trends, predict potential health issues, and personalize care plans. Features to look for include:
Visual data trends and graphs
Predictive analytics and risk stratification
Customizable reporting tools
EHR and Telehealth Integration
For a streamlined workflow, the remote patient monitoring software should integrate with your existing Electronic Health Records (EHR) and telehealth platforms. This ensures all patient data is centralized and easily accessible. Look for:
Bi-directional EHR integration (import/export patient data)
Compatibility with leading EHR systems
Built-in telehealth features (video visits, messaging)
Patient Engagement Tools
Engaging patients in their own healthcare boosts outcomes and satisfaction. The ideal remote patient monitoring software includes:
Patient portals and mobile apps for easy access to health data
Educational resources and reminders for medication or appointments
Secure messaging between patients and providers
Robust Security and Compliance
Healthcare data is highly sensitive and must be protected at all costs. Ensure the remote patient monitoring software you choose adheres to strict security protocols and industry regulations:
HIPAA compliance for data protection
End-to-end encryption of data in transit and at rest
Regular security updates and audits
Role-based access control for staff
Customizable Workflows and Protocols
Every healthcare practice has unique needs. The right remote patient monitoring software should allow customization of workflows and clinical protocols:
Customizable care pathways for different conditions
Automated task assignments and escalation protocols
Flexible scheduling for follow-ups and interventions
Scalability and Flexibility
As your practice grows, your technology needs will evolve. Opt for a remote patient monitoring software that is scalable and can accommodate an increasing number of patients and users:
Cloud-based infrastructure for seamless scalability
Modular features that can be added as needed
Support for multi-location practices
Reliable Technical Support and Training
Implementing new technology can be challenging. Choose a vendor that offers comprehensive support and training for both providers and patients:
24/7 technical support via phone, chat, or email
Onboarding and training resources
Regular software updates and training on new features
